About Raffles

Raffles is a residential suburb located on the western side of Carlisle, the county town of Cumbria in the North West of England. Primarily characterised by its housing estates, it serves as a significant area for family homes and local living within the city's urban footprint. The neighbourhood provides essential local amenities, including schools and shops, catering to the daily needs of its inhabitants and forming an integral part of Carlisle's wider community.
